Area Birders,

David Raines, a Buchanan County Bird Club member, called me from work today
to give me this information.

Yesterday evening at the Grundy High School building he estimated 4000
Chimney Swifts circling then diving into the chimney of the school. He said
it took about 20 minutes for all of them to finally go inside.

Also near his home in the Breaks community near the Breaks Park he saw
around 50 Common Nighthawks wheeling and turning over the fields.
